Two-year dividend famine is set to continue

February 8, 2010

Stock market experts are warning of another year of dividend famine as some of Britain’s biggest dividend mainstays struggle to maintain payments to shareholders.

Dividends from British-listed companies fell by £10 billion, or 15 per cent, last year to £56.9 billion and, while they may creep up this year, they will still fall well short of the £66 billion distributed in 2008, according to the Capita Registrars Dividend Monitor.
